With an aim to create an environment for holistic development of children, small schools with less than 20 students will be combined to form to cluster of schools in the state.

The education department has identified over 4,000 government schools with less than 20 students across Maharashtra. According to the data provided by the Commissionerate of Education, Maharashtra, approximately 50,000 students are studying in these schools where around 9,000 teachers are imparting education.

This number, according to the government, is huge in totality, but children studying in these schools are missing on holistic development.

Commissioner of education Maharashtra, Suraj Mandhare, said, “The purpose of going to school is not just study but also socialise with other children and become a responsible citizen. Schools with such small number of students do not provide any such opportunity to socialise. Additionally, they lack basic infrastructure facilities, too. Therefore, there is an urgent need to address this issue.”

Including teachers, facilities in government schools are linked to the number of students. The model of first cluster of schools created in Panshet by Pune Zilla Parishad (ZP) will be emulated across the state.

Elaborating on the plan, Mandhare added, “In Pune district, the zilla parishad has carried out an experiment that can be treated as a role model. If original schools are far away from the cluster school, transport arrangement can be provided through government funds or a CSR partner or local resources.”

The Panshet cluster of schools combined 16 public schools located within a distance of 10 kilometres. A newly constructed building with required facilities accommodates 250 students of the cluster, where transport is also provided free of cost.

The school buildings will be vacated after the creation of cluster school and will be utilised for other government facilities. “If the building is good enough to house any other public facility such as an Anganwadi, that can be thought of,” said Mandhare.

The state government has been facing a serious flak after its decision to close the schools having less than 20 students. According to many, merging of schools would mean increase in the distance that students would have to commute, resulting in dropouts.

At a recent meeting of the Maharashtra school education department, policy decisions on “cluster of schools” were discussed, however, a detailed plan is yet to be prepared on merging of schools.
